Required Qualifications

  • Associate Degree in Nursing is required (BSN is preferred).
  • Current RN licensure or compact licensure recognized by the Texas Board of Nursing upon hire.
  • BCLS – Basic Cardiac Life Support certification through the American Heart Association, effective upon hire.
  • NRP – Neonatal Resuscitation Program certification required within 90 days of hire.
  • ACLS – Advanced Cardiac Life Support certification required within 90 days of hire.
  • IFM – Intermediate Fetal Monitoring certification required within 12 months of hire.
  • STABLE program certification required within 6 months of hire.
  • At least 1 year of clinical nursing experience or completion of an RN residency program.
